Hoosiers Bounce Back: Defense Secures Win Amidst Sluggish Play

Indiana's basketball team demonstrated resilience in their 73-53 victory over Lindenwood, overcoming a lethargic start and persistent rebounding woes. Despite being outrebounded, the Hoosiers' defense proved pivotal, sparking a decisive second-half run that secured their fifth win of the season. This performance underscored the team's fluctuating "Jekyll and Hyde" identity, where offensive struggles can impact energy levels, but defensive intensity remains a key to success.

Coach Darian DeVries emphasized the need for consistent energy throughout the game, noting that the team needs to learn to fight through offensive droughts. The Hoosiers showed improvement in this area compared to previous games, where shooting slumps negatively impacted their defense. However, the team's scoring and shooting efficiency have decreased significantly in recent games compared to their explosive start.

As Indiana wraps up the easier portion of its non-conference schedule, the team faces a tougher slate of opponents, including Kansas State and Kentucky. The Hoosiers' ability to establish a consistent, defense-oriented foundation, unaffected by offensive performance, will be crucial for their success against high-major competition.
